MAJOR DRIVES

Share Your Lunch (May - August)
Summer is the season of childhood hunger. Help provide food to children who normally receive free meals at school.

Holiday Food & Fund Drive (October - January)
The winter holidays bring out our giving spirits. Feed others throughout the year by coordinating a Holiday Food & Fund Drive.

OTHER DRIVES

General Food & Fund Drive (year-round)
Feed people in need by coordinating a drive at the time of year that is most convenient for you.

Letter Carriers’ Stamp Out Hunger (May)
Your letter carrier will pick-up bags of food from your home and deliver them to the Food Bank.

Lenten Food & Fund Drive (February - March)
Lent is a time of fasting and abstinence, yet some of our neighbors do not have a choice. Your congregation can help those in need by hosting a drive during Lent.

High Holy Days Drive (September – October)
Synagogues and community organizations run food and fund drives between Rosh Hashanah, and Yom Kippur.

Scouting for Food (November)
The Boy Scouts will pick-up bags of food from your home and deliver them to the Food Bank.
